Charles是一款非常流行的應(yīng)用程序,專門用于HTTP和HTTPS流量分析,它有助于開發(fā)者、網(wǎng)絡(luò)管理員以及網(wǎng)絡(luò)安全專家監(jiān)控和分析網(wǎng)站的安全性。
概述
為了確保Charles能在各種環(huán)境下正常工作并提供準(zhǔn)確的數(shù)據(jù),您可能需要在自己的設(shè)備上安裝一個SSL證書,本文將詳細(xì)介紹如何為Charles下載并安裝SSL證書的過程。
準(zhǔn)備工作
1、硬件需求:
- 運(yùn)行Charles的電腦。
2、軟件需求:
- 已經(jīng)擁有一張有效的SSL證書。
- 一個支持HTTPS的瀏覽器,如Chrome或Firefox。
3、證書來源:
- 可以從互聯(lián)網(wǎng)免費(fèi)下載SSL證書,或購買商業(yè)證書以提高安全性。
安裝Charles
啟動Charles后,打開瀏覽器的開發(fā)工具(通??梢酝ㄟ^F12快捷鍵實(shí)現(xiàn)),開發(fā)工具應(yīng)位于瀏覽器的頂部或右側(cè)面板。
手動添加SSL證書
1、在Charles中,找到并點(diǎn)擊菜單欄中的"SSL Certificate"選項。
2、在彈出的窗口中,您可以有以下兩種選擇:
導(dǎo)入本地文件:如果您已有本地的SSL證書文件,請點(diǎn)擊“Import Local File”按鈕并上傳該文件。
獲取自簽名證書:如果您尚未下載SSL證書或想要使用Charles自帶的測試證書,請點(diǎn)擊“Get Self-Signed Certificate”按鈕,此證書僅為驗證目的而設(shè)計,不具備完整功能。
配置代理
在Charles設(shè)置界面中,找到“HTTP Proxy”部分,配置Charles作為代理服務(wù)器,輸入目標(biāo)網(wǎng)站的URL地址,勾選“Use for all protocols”。
測試連接
打開瀏覽器,嘗試訪問配置好的代理服務(wù)器,若一切設(shè)置無誤,您應(yīng)該能夠在Charles端口看到目標(biāo)網(wǎng)站的流量。
通過上述步驟,您就能成功為Charles添加SSL證書并開始使用,確保您的Charles配置準(zhǔn)確無誤后,它便能有效地捕獲并分析HTTP/HTTPS流量了。
本文檔僅供參考,具體操作請參閱Charles官方文檔,希望本文能幫助您順利完成Charles的SSL證書配置!
*版權(quán)聲明:文中所有信息及圖片均來自公開資源,未經(jīng)允許不得擅自使用。